Always consider both the price of your phone and the price of the plan. Some providers offer great discounts on the phones they sell, but they get you in the end with higher priced plans. This means some savings initially, but more out of pocket expenses in the long run.

Know the cell phone laws in your state when it comes to driving. In many states, it’s illegal to text on a cell phone and drive. Even if it’s technically legal in your state, it’s still not a good idea. Many accidents occur due to text messaging. If you must communicate, call using a hands-free device or pull off the road to text.

The code to check your messages is a default code, usually a part of your telephone number. As soon as you have set up your messaging program, change the code to something memorable. This way, others can not access your personal messages even if you lose your phone or leave it sitting around.

Clean up the music that you do not want on your phone, as this will save a lot of memory. If you use iTunes, you can do this by going to your computer and deleting them from your music library. When you connect your phone, it will Sync up and delete the unneeded songs.

Sometimes signing a longer term contract is worth it to get the phone you want. Some providers will offer the best prices if you are willing to sign on for their service for a year or two. Just make sure you’re willing to commit to the contract, because ending the term early can cost a lot in penalties.

If you’ve got a weak signal, consider shutting your cell phone off for a time. Weak signals are notorious battery hogs for your cell phone. You’ll lose power very quickly when you’re in an area with only a bar or two. If you plan to be out all day, shutting down your phone for a period is your best bet to keep some battery in play later.





Does your phone battery go dead easily? Maybe your signal is weak. Weak signals can drain batteries. If you aren’t going to use your phone, never place it somewhere with a weak signal, like your closet or drawer.

Do not download any apps unless you know they are from a trusted source. Anybody can make an app and sell it. Sometimes, there are trackers or other undesired things within them. Knowing that the person or company is reputable will reduce the chance of you getting a virus or tracker in your phone.

In order to save battery power, turn off WiFi on your phone. This will constantly be searching for a connection, and that takes battery power to occur. If you only turn it on when you need it, you will end up saving a lot of power when you need it most.
